Analysis
Greece recorded 1,326 units per person for liabilities, international liquidity, liabilities to nonresidents in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 4.0% on the previous year and down 80.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, liabilities, international liquidity, liabilities to nonresidents in Greece peaked at 10,496 units per person in 2007 and was at its lowest, 887.13 units per person, in 2001.
That places Greece 56th out of 170 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Liabilities, International Liquidity, Liabilities to Nonresidents (ODCS) (US dollar)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Liabilities, International Liquidity, Liabilities to Nonresidents (ODCS) (US dollar)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Liabilities, International Liquidity, Liabilities to Nonresidents International Monetary Fund
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
